Profile of Blue Ventures
Blue Ventures is a not-for-profit organisation dedicated to facilitating projects and expedition that enhance global marine conservation and research. Since 2002, we have run over 16 expeditions to Madagascar, Tanzania, New Zealand, The Comoros and South Africa.
Blue Ventures co-ordinates expeditions consisting of scientists and volunteers working hand-in-hand with local biologists, marine institutes, NGOs, and communities whose livelihoods depend on these ecosystems, to carry out research, environmental awareness and conservation programmes at threatened habitats around the world.
Problems he’s had and how he’s overcome them:
Setting up and running a fully-functioning diving and research centre 250km from the nearest phone/road in South-West Madagascar, with no communication other than by satellite telephone. We overcame it by an incredible amount of hard work!
Major successes:
Last year we were highly commended in the responsible travel awards, this year we have won the SEED Awards. Our project incorporating; Madagascar’s first community-run, self-sustaining experimental Marine Protected Area was chosen as a ‘shining example of how economic development and environmental protection can go hand in hand’, by the international panel which made the selection.
